First off, before you leave the hotel be sure to shower and put on good deodorant. Then don’t forget to put on your good waterproof shoes. During the inevitable 4:00pm daily summer storm and subsequent outdoor attraction suspensions find a good spot under shelter while you wait for the 15minute storm to pass. Then prepare for it to get very muggy after the storm passes as the water evaporates off the ground once it heats up again. Stay hydrated and be sure to reapply the deodorant that you brought with you in your park backpack.

No outdoor rollercoaster in rain usually because rain in florida = T storms. Seaworld is a good park to go to on a rainy day-plenty of theatres covered and less rides. Epcots also a good plan because you can spend plenty of time in future world inside ‘the seas’, ‘the land’ or ‘innoventions’ 🙂
Buy a poncho or take one with you if its expected to be rainy season, it will be put to good use! Make sure you clean them and dry them out after every use back at the hotel/villa though or they can get mouldy.
